We are AUSIEX. With over 25 years of experience in the local market and the backing of a multinational trading technology powerhouse, we’re AUSIEX. We specialise in equities execution, clearing & settlement services, and equities administration for financial intermediaries. Since 1994, we’ve used our deep, local expertise to deliver solutions that seamlessly connect our clients to markets. We are powered by Nomura Research Institute (NRI), a global leader in technology and operations services. We’re infusing NRI’s proven technology capability and tradition of innovation, with our trusted trading solutions and local market expertise.

In 2025, we expanded our group by welcoming FIIG Securities, a respected Australian fixed income specialist with over 25 years of experience. FIIG Securities manages billions under advice and serves 6,000 private clients, providing investors with access to expert insights and investment opportunities across the fixed income asset class. Their focus on delivering consistent, reliable income and capital stability perfectly complements our service offering.

See yourself in our team

FIIG is progressively rolling out a full business platform integration capability. The objective of this initiative is to support business optimisation, and leverage technology to achieve a high standard of customer service and efficiency across FIIG’s entire business. This staged implementation must be designed and implemented in a way that ensures minimal impact to normal business operations.

Senior Developer role responsibilities
  • Performing enhancement and maintenance on FIIG's Microsoft .NET Core based Web Platform.
  • Performing other operational enhancements and maintenance on FIIG’s systems to support migration to the new platform.
  • Participating in design workshops, and assisting in the development / review of target state designs and data migration strategies.
  • Leading a team of offshore developers and testers who will deliver the technical outcomes.
  • Pro-actively identifying areas of business / technical risk, and where improvements can be made to improve quality and efficiency.
  • Performing deep analysis of features within the legacy trading system and transferring this knowledge to business and technical audiences.
  • Playing a supporting role in improving / managing the tools, systems and methodology used within the FIIG.

The new business platform will be predominately based on a cohesive set of configurable commercial products. Some custom build will be needed to meet specific business requirements, integration needs, and for interim measures needed to facilitate transition.
